[Lekuti Sichos vol 4 p.1027] Lost and Found Once, on Erev Shavuos, when the Rebbe Rashab went into yechidus with his father the Rebbe Maharash, he was told that Shavuos commemorates: 1- The gift of the Torah –The revealed Torah which everyone gets 2- -The yahrzeit of the Baal Shem Tov –The hidden Torah which many get 3- -The yahrzeit of King David --The ability to serve Hashem with self-nullification [through changing one’s nature], which is given only to those who have an intense, essential desire for it.
